Panchkula Police Conducts Raid, Arrests 60 for Illegal Gambling

In a significant crackdown, Panchkula police raided a cafe late at night, arresting 60 individuals, including 12 girls and 48 boys, for illegal gambling. The operation, conducted by the Crime Branch and Anti-Narcotics Cell, resulted in the seizure of ₹3,69,000 in cash, 20 bottles of illegal liquor, and 21 vehicles. Legal actions are underway against the cafe's management. This incident highlights ongoing issues related to illegal gambling in the area.
